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are in the central Whangarei area, head towards the Whangarei Town Basin. From the main street (Cameron Street), walk towards the waterfront. You will see a pathway that leads directly to the Town Basin area. Continue walking along the pathway, and keep an eye out for the large parking lot on your right. Just before you reach the parking lot, you will see a sign for 'Wairau Maori Art Gallery'. The gallery is located at 2 Quayside, right by the water's edge.

  • Public Transport

    To get to Wairau Maori Art Gallery using public transport, take a bus from any Whangarei bus stop towards the Town Basin. Ensure that you check the bus schedule for the correct route, as buses may vary. Once you arrive at the Town Basin bus stop, disembark and head towards the waterfront. Walk along the path and follow the signs leading to Quayside. The gallery is located at 2 Quayside, just a short walk from the bus stop.

  • Cycling

    If you are cycling in Whangarei, make your way towards the Town Basin. Follow the cycle paths that connect to the waterfront area. Once you reach the Town Basin, continue cycling along the waterfront towards Quayside. You will find Wairau Maori Art Gallery at 2 Quayside, right next to the water. There are bike racks available for you to lock up your bike while you visit the gallery.

Discover more about Wairau Maori Art Gallery

Nestled in the heart of Whangārei, the Wairau Maori Art Gallery stands as a testament to the rich cultural tapestry and artistic expression of the Māori people. This art gallery is not just a space to view art; it is a portal into the soul of Aotearoa, New Zealand. Visitors are greeted by a diverse collection of traditional and contemporary Māori artworks that showcase the unique perspectives, stories, and skills of local artists. Each piece reflects the deep connection between the Māori culture and the land, offering insights into their history, beliefs, and artistry. The gallery itself is an inviting space, designed to enhance the viewing experience while fostering a sense of community and cultural exchange. As you wander through the thoughtfully curated exhibitions, you will encounter everything from intricate carvings and woven textiles to striking paintings that capture the essence of Māori identity. The gallery hosts regular events and workshops, further enriching the experience and providing opportunities for visitors to engage with the culture in meaningful ways. A visit to Wairau Maori Art Gallery is essential for anyone looking to deepen their understanding of New Zealand's indigenous culture. The gallery is open daily from 10 AM to 4 PM, ensuring ample opportunity to explore its treasures. Whether you're an art enthusiast or simply curious about Māori heritage, this gallery offers a unique and enriching experience that will leave a lasting impression.
